What does law of constant composition applies to?

The law of constant composition says that, in any particular chemical compound, all samples of that compound will be made up of the same elements in the same proportion or ratio. For example, any water molecule is always made up of two hydrogen atoms and one oxygen atom in a 2: 1 ratio.

image

What is the law of definite composition and give an example?

This states that all samples of a given chemical compound have the same elemental composition by mass. For example, oxygen makes up about 8/9 of the mass of any sample of pure water, while hydrogen makes up the remaining 1/9 of the mass.

What is the law of constant composition?

In chemistry, the law of constant composition (also known as the law of definite proportions) states that samples of a pure compound always contain the same elements in the same mass proportion. This law, together with the law of multiple proportions, is the basis for stoichiometry in chemistry.

What are some examples of non-stoichiometric compounds?

There are some non-stoichiometric compounds that exhibit a variable composition from one sample to another. An example is wustite, a type of iron oxide that may contain 0.83 to 0.95 iron per each oxygen.

Is Proust's law universally valid?

The law of definite proportions or Proust’s law is not universally valid. There are some exceptions, which are discussed below. The law does not hold when there is the presence of an isotope in the compound. Isotopes are a variant of an element that has the same atomic number but different atomic mass due to the presence of extra neutrons.

Is water a chemical compound?

This is true irrespective of source or method of preparation of that chemical compound. Consider a molecule of water H 2 O. Now, water is a chemical compound since it is made up of more than one element. Any water molecule consists ...

Does Proust's law apply to non-stoichiometric compounds?

Non-stoichiometric compounds also do not obey Proust’s law. In non-stoichiometric compounds, the ratio of elements fluctuates within certain range. Classic example is ferrous oxide, whose ideal formula is FeO. But due to crystallographic vacancies, Fe atoms can vary from 0.83 to 0.95 for each O atom. Because of this variation, the proportions of elements (Fe, O) will vary, and Proust’s law fails again.

Do polymers have a fixed composition?

Many polymers (like protein, carbohydrates) do not have a fixed composition. These compounds also break the law.

Law of Definition Proportions Example

  • The law of definite proportions says water will always contain 1/9 hydrogen and 8/9 oxygen by mass. The sodium and chlorine in table salt combine according to the rule in NaCl. The atomic weight of sodium is about 23 and that of chlorine is about 35, so from the law one may conclude dissociating 58 grams of NaCl would produce about 23 g of sodium and 35 g of chlorine.
